http://mrssarahconner.weebly.com/uploads/1/6/6/7/16672632/heat_chapter_2.pdf Web2. Convection: The transfer of heat by the movement of fluids or gases. This occurs when a fluid or gas is heated and expands, becoming less dense and rising, while the cooler fluid or gas sinks, creating a continuous cycle of movement that transfers heat. 3. Radiation: The transfer of heat through electromagnetic waves.

They can also … theoretical underpinnings of cbtWebThe Frayer Model is a graphic organizer with four prompts to help students think about the meaning of a new word or concept by activating their prior knowledge. The Chartconsists of four boxes to complete—definition, characteristics, examples, and non-examples—and an oval in the center for the word or concept being studied.
